
Penn State’s Course Management System, ANGEL (http://cms.psu.edu), was upgraded from version 7.1 to version 7.3 during the weekend of May 16. The new version of ANGEL features enhancements to several existing tools, and several new tools will help course editors perform administrative tasks. For the most part, however, the functionality should remain familiar to users. Late yesterday afternoon Blackboard Inc. announced it was acquiring ANGEL Learning, Inc. The acquisition is expected to become final later this month. We are in the process of evaluating the meaning of this acquisition and how it impacts the Penn State community.

Penn State’s Course Management System, ANGEL (http://cms.psu.edu), will be upgraded from version 7.1 to version 7.3 the weekend of May 16. The new version of ANGEL will feature enhancements to several existing tools, and several new tools will help course editors perform administrative tasks. Users will also see several minor interface changes. For the most part, however, the functionality will remain familiar to users. Learn more about the new features in version 7.3.
From 6:00 p.m. Friday, May 15 to 6:00 a.m. Monday, May 18, ANGEL will be unavailable while Information Technology Services (ITS) performs the upgrade. ITS regrets any inconvenience this outage may cause. For any questions, contact ANGEL support at angelsupport@psu.edu.

Over the course of a year, ITS worked on developing a strategy for ANGEL at Penn State in the coming years. The attached ANGEL Vision document serves to explain that strategy. This document serves two distinct purposes. The first is to outline some new thinking as it relates to the overall flexibility of ANGEL as we move forward. The second is to highlight future architectural goals in anticipation of continued growth and increased demand of ANGEL throughout the university. ITS will use this document as we continue to pursue our strategic partnership with ANGEL Learning, Inc.
